What the source record says
Roughly 100,000 sq ft near Interstate 90, inside a residential and commercial development already under construction in Cle Elum. Developer projects 20 to 40 full-time positions. Because the site is covered by a pre-existing development agreement with the city, it may proceed despite the moratorium.
